    I would also encourage you to check out the fast-reset hybrid archon build.

    http://us.battle.net/d3/en/forum/topic/7004698743

    You will have little mobility issue because this build does not assume you will keep up archon forever. Instead, it uses different means (LL or ET) to reset archon CD within seconds. This build is also good for high MP because you can pretty much use archon at will, even with short duration for elite or boss.

    this looks pretty interesting, but is there some reason you're doing all of this instead of archon?

    Let's do a calculation. Sleet storm is 280%. The only dmg add that you probably use here, and not in archon is the slow time 20%, and the 15% on bonechill. That is 280%*(1+0.2+0.15) = 378%.

    Archon is 300% without improved archon and 375% (300 * 1.25) with. So the raw damage is quite close, but you have to use 3 slots to achieve it. So improve archon + sparkflint will be more dps just by doing the numbers.

    However, note that archon also buffs defense, and that its beam can hit more mobs at the same time, and also at range. That makes archon safer to use, and potentially also higher AOE dps because it can melt everything on screen in the same direction.

    Now it does have a CD but there are builds (like the perma archon for low MP, and hybrid for high) that minimize the down-time. The trade off of course is while this sleetstorm build has no CD, it is using AP so either you may have to sacrifice some gear for APOC, which will lower the DPS.

    Having said all these, this is an interesting build, and i would try it out tonight.
